Seat-map renderer alert (Stagelight v4). Fires when the Velvetrow theatre seat map fails to paint within 5 seconds or renders overlapping seats — usually a bad venue config pushed with a release. If this pops during your rollout window, pause the deploy and check the canary venues first. The rollback steps are on the page below.

runbook for badug-kadup: https://confluence.zemvarlabs.internal/projects/browse/display/projects/bd1b

### Ceremony Step 4 — Seal the LargeDiff signing key

Before sealing, confirm the Vexley diff viewer builds cleanly against the 2GB fixture set and that chunked rendering passes all checks. As the contractor on rotation, read each verification aloud while the witness initials the ledger. Place the signing token in the tamper-evident bag and photograph the seal number. The token's recovery envelope opens with the passphrase below.

unlock words, yawig-kagef: gordor-holvan-ulaael-pramir-ulaiel-tamdor

## Deploying the Gatewick Proctor Queue

Deploys are pretty painless: push to main, wait for the pipeline, then watch the queue drain dashboard for five minutes. If candidates pile up mid-exam, roll back first and ask questions later — the queue replays safely. Everything the workers care about lives in one config block, shown here for reference.

settings of bafof-yagef:
JOROX_PIN=8740
JOROX_TENANT=pelox
JOROX_METRICS_HOST=metrics.jorox.qorvelworks.internal
JOROX_SEAL=seal_c78f63c1
JOROX_STANDBY_TEAM=norax

Quarterly Planning Note — Divestiture of the Coastal Tooling Unit

For the finance team: the sale of the Coastal Tooling unit to Pellmark Industries remains on track for close in Q3. Please finalize the carve-out balance sheet, reconcile intercompany positions, and prepare the working-capital adjustment schedule by month-end. Audit support requests should be prioritized. For planning purposes, note the following sensitive item:

internal memo for hawef-kahif: The finance team signed off on a budget of $25.9 million for Project Sorox. The renewal with Pelokek Logistics closes at $51.7 million a year, 52 percent below the last contract.